In Girlawhirl's office, computers are as essential to getting work done as the people who sit behind them. Emails keep everyone in the loop and software makes presentations not only look professional but also allows for them to be customized for individual clients…

Girlawhirl admits that she feels lost without her computer, but there's one thing she's never felt is appropriate for the office: IM-ing. She had one assistant who had a serious IM habit and didn't even bother to conceal it from Girlawhirl. When she looked over this woman's shoulder as they were updating a presentation or working on a layout of some sort, they'd constantly be interrupted with messages pertaining to her evening plans or gossip about boyfriends and favorite lip glosses.

 

But these days, Girlawhirl's noticed that IM-ing has become part of the office protocol for many people. She's even been told by one of her most important clients that it's his preferred mode of communication throughout the day, which initiated much discussion with her IT department. To support her need to have IM installed on the computers of the account executives and coordinators who work with this customer, Girlawhirl showed them a recent article by Kate Lorenz at CareerBuilder.com, “WAN2CHAT? 10 Tips For IM-ing at Work,” which explained how IM-ing really has become acceptable at the office.

 

And pretty soon, everyone in Girlawhirl's company got little IM widgets on their computer screens.
